Mail client crash via NULL key dereference
Published May 4, 2026 · Updated May 4, 2026
NULL pointer dereference in Mutt before 2.3.2 allows attackers to crash the mail client while signature status is displayed. The show_sig_summary function dereferences key->subkeys for an expired-key signature even when show_one_sig_status supplies a NULL key after GPG_ERR_NO_PUBKEY. Exploitation requires user interaction and a high-complexity local trigger; the documented consequence is interruption of the Mutt process only.
